India captain Mahendra Singh Dhoni won the toss and elected to bat against Sri Lanka in the tri-series final at the Premadasa Stadium on Monday.


India brought in batsman Virat Kohli in place of opener Dinesh Karthik, while Sri Lanka retained the same team that beat the Indians by 139 runs in a league match on Saturday.



India: Mahendra Singh Dhoni (capt), Sachin Tendulkar, Virat Kohli, Rahul Dravid, Yuvraj Singh, Suresh Raina, Yusuf Pathan, Harbhajan Singh, Ishant Sharma, Ashish Nehra, Rudra Pratap Singh




Sri Lanka: Kumar Sangakkara (capt), Tillakaratne Dilshan, Sanath Jayasuriya, Mahela Jayawardene, Chamara Kapugedara, Thilina Kandamby, Angelo Mathews, Nuwan Kulasekara, Lasith Malinga, Ajantha Mendis, Thilan Thushara
